Marta Minujín (Buenos Aires, 1943) presents her first solo exhibition in Mexico in over twenty-five years. To Live in Art brings together a selection of historical and recent works that reflect her profound impact on the global art scene. For more than seventy years, Minujín has challenged and expanded the boundaries of contemporary art, participating in movements that broke with convention and helped establish her as a leading figure in Argentine art and an international icon.
